Charterhouse Road is in Godalming and in Waverley district. GU7 2AL is located in the Godalming Binscombe & Charterhouse elect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of South West Surrey.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

Safety

Is Charterhouse Road dangerous?

Over the last 12 months, the overall crime rate around Charterhouse Road was 33.6 per 1,000 residents, which is 33.9% lower than the Godalming Binscombe & Charterhouse average. The most reported crime type was Anti-social behaviour.

Charterhouse Road has the 31st highest crime rate of 69 local areas in Godalming Binscombe & Charterhouse and the 173rd highest crime rate of 359 local areas in Waverley .

Violent and sexual offences accounted for around 16.8 crimes per 1,000 residents and have been rising year on year. Over the last decade, overall crime has fallen by about -56.1%.

Employment

GU7 2AL area has a very high level of entrepreneurship. Only 11% of streets have higher percent of entrepreneur residents. 15% of population in this area is self-employed, while the average in the UK is 9.7%. High number of entrepreneurs usually leads to relatively high economic growth, higher paid jobs and better quality of life in the area.

GU7 2AL area has a low unemployment rate. According to Census 2021, 1% residents of this area were unemployed, while the average in the UK was 4.83%. A low level of unemployment in an area indicates a strong job market, where most people who are seeking work can find employment. This generally reflects a healthy economy in the area.
